Skip to content

Commit

Permalink
Update abstract parsing regex
Browse files Browse the repository at this point in the history
  • Loading branch information
calvinlu3 committed Jun 14, 2024
1 parent 7d926ad commit 4d573cd
Showing 1 changed file with 1 addition and 3 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-10,8 +10,6 @@
import org.json.JSONObject;
import org.mskcc.cbio.oncokb.bo.*;
import org.mskcc.cbio.oncokb.model.*;
import org.mskcc.cbio.oncokb.model.TumorType;
import org.mskcc.cbio.oncokb.bo.OncokbTranscriptService;
import org.mskcc.cbio.oncokb.model.clinicalTrialsMathcing.Tumor;
import org.mskcc.cbio.oncokb.util.*;
import org.springframework.stereotype.Controller;
Expand Down Expand Up @@ -962,7 +960,7 @@ private void setDocuments(String str, Evidence evidence) {
Set<Article> docs = new HashSet<>();
ArticleBo articleBo = ApplicationContextSingleton.getArticleBo();
Pattern pmidPattern = Pattern.compile("PMIDs?:?\\s*([\\d,\\s*]+)", Pattern.CASE_INSENSITIVE);
Pattern abstractPattern = Pattern.compile("\\(?\\s*Abstract\\s*:([^\\)]*);?\\s*\\)?", Pattern.CASE_INSENSITIVE);
Pattern abstractPattern = Pattern.compile("\\(?\\s*Abstract\\s*:(.*(?:\\([^()]*\\).*?)*);?\\s*\\)", Pattern.CASE_INSENSITIVE);
Pattern abItemPattern = Pattern.compile("(.*?)\\.\\s*(http.*)", Pattern.CASE_INSENSITIVE);
Matcher m = pmidPattern.matcher(str);
int start = 0;
Expand Down

0 comments on commit 4d573cd

Please sign in to comment.